Bangkok Authorities Investigate Possible Links in Violent Bitcoin Cash Exchange Robbery

Main Idea

A violent robbery in Bangkok involving a cryptocurrency cash exchange highlights rising security risks and potential links to previous crypto crimes in Thailand.

Key Points

1. A robbery in Bangkok's Central Plaza Ladprao parking lot involved $100,000 in cash intended for cryptocurrency purchases, signaling security risks in crypto transactions.

2. Authorities are investigating possible connections to a November 2024 robbery in Phuket, where a Ukrainian national was kidnapped and extorted for 250,000 USDT.

3. The lack of widespread crypto ATMs in Thailand forces users to rely on intermediaries, increasing exposure to fraud and violence.

4. The incident underscores the urgent need for enhanced oversight in Thailand’s crypto ecosystem to prevent related crimes and protect investors.

5. Global trends show similar challenges, with criminals exploiting gaps in crypto security, including kidnappings and cyberattacks.
